This line from the quarterly report may be scaring a few off (typical pinksheeter language, the translation is :"we'll be diluting massively to raise cash"):

"Twelve-Month Business Outlook

We do not currently have funds sufficient to carry out any of our operations, or to execute our plan of becoming a natural resource company. In order to act upon our operating plan discussed herein, we must be able to raise sufficient funds from (i) debt financing; or, (ii) new investments from private investors. There can be no assurance that we will be able to obtain debt or equity financing or generate sufficient revenue to produce positive cash flow from operations."




When they are done, you'll see the price stabilize and the volume drop off somewhat.
